About the job
Responsibilities
Build reusable patterns
- Design reusable patterns for agentic service workflows, including orchestration, human-in-the-loop protocols, override and escalation logic, and quality safeguards.
- Establish standards that builders can apply independently.
- Prototype workflows to validate patterns, identify gaps, and unblock difficult problems, then extract reusable capabilities and hand them off.
- Incorporate learnings from each build into shared patterns to improve speed and safety.
Shape the platform
- Influence Product priorities by turning builder friction into specific, evidence-backed requests.
- Prototype capabilities missing from the platform to validate their value before investment.
- Identify gaps between builder needs and existing platform capabilities.
Prioritize opportunities and measurement
- Rank automation opportunities by volume, risk, and customer impact using SOPs, operational metrics, and interaction data.
- Partner with Data to define consistent workflow-performance measurements.
- Identify processes that should not be automated.
Own quality and governance
- Represent customer impact in Legal, Security, Compliance, and platform reviews so requirements are incorporated into reusable patterns.
- Report portfolio performance to senior stakeholders in a concise, action-oriented manner.
Requirements
- 8+ years of experience in operations, product, or AI roles.
- At least 2 years designing and deploying AI-assisted or agentic workflows in production.
- Hands-on experience with agentic tooling, orchestration frameworks, or MCP-style integrations, including multi-agent coordination.
- Strong understanding of LLM systems, prompt design, evaluation, and model behavior at scale.
- Experience designing human-in-the-loop systems with escalation logic, override controls, and compliance-aware checkpoints.
- Ability to define and diagnose workflow metrics, including solve rate, assist rate, containment, and escalation quality.
- Experience influencing Product, Engineering, Legal, Security, and Compliance through writing, design reviews, and high-stakes forums.
- Familiarity with responsible AI, governance, and production risk management.
- Experience working in a function undergoing significant change and building new capabilities in ambiguous environments.
Nice-to-haves
- Experience with ret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) architectures and retrieval-quality optimization.
- Ability to assess whether data structures, data quality, and data governance support reliable agentic performance.
- Experience in SaaS, fintech, or regulated environments.
- Exposure to AI governance or safety-oriented review processes.
Compensation
- Denver and most major metro locations: $168,420-$210,525 per year.
- San Francisco and New York: $197,895-$247,369 per year.
- Full-time employees receive benefits and equity.
